B站上的python练习
products = [["iphone", 6888], ["MacPro", 14800], ["小米6", 2499], ["Coffee", 31], ["Book", 60], ["Nike",699]]
print("-"*5+"商品列表"+"-"*5)
i = 0
for name in products:
print(i,end="\t")
print(products[i][0],end="\t") #products第一个[代表在products列表内第一个【】] 第二个[代表【】内的第几个数值]
print(products[i][1])
i += 1
list = [] # 定义一个空列表作为购物车
sum_money=0
while 1: # 建立一个无限循环
question = input("您需要购买什么?:")
if question !="q":
question = int(question)
list.append(products[question][0])
sum_money=sum_money+int(products[question][1]) #计算总金额
elif question == "q":
print("您购买的物品如下:",end="\t")
print(list,end="\t")
print("共计%d元"%(sum_money))
print("谢谢光临")
break #结束